Euphoria In AI Left Software Overpriced
- The AI trade's euphoria left software trading at extreme revenue multiples that now face monetization questions.
- Tim Seymour and others warn the sector's pullback may reflect repricing, not the death of AI.
Rotation Into Real Economy Stocks
- Rotation favored cyclicals and real-economy names as investors fled tech.
- Panelists noted transport, staples and utilities outperformed amid sector rebalancing.
AMD Beat But China Caveats Temper Rally
- AMD beat revenue and guided higher but China sales and modest beats tempered enthusiasm.
- Analysts expect product ramp and larger data-center racks later in the year to drive growth.
